Partager via


Windows.ApplicationModel.VoiceCommands Espace de noms

Fournit la prise en charge de la gestion des commandes vocales dans Cortana, entrées par parole ou texte, pour accéder aux fonctionnalités et fonctionnalités à partir d’une application en arrière-plan. Lorsqu’une application gère une commande vocale en arrière-plan, elle peut afficher des commentaires sur le canevas Cortana et communiquer avec l’utilisateur à l’aide de la voix Cortana .

Un fichier VCD (Voice Command Definition) doit être inscrit par l’application pour permettre à la commande vocale d’accéder à ses fonctionnalités. Pour plus d’informations sur la création et l’inscription d’un fichier VCD (Voice Command Definition) pour votre application, consultez Lancer une application en arrière-plan avec des commandes vocales .

Notes

Une commande vocale est un énoncé, défini dans un fichier VCD (Voice Command Definition), qui est dirigé vers une application installée via Cortana. L’application peut être lancée au premier plan ou en arrière-plan en fonction du niveau et de la complexité de l’interaction. Par exemple, les commandes vocales qui requièrent un contexte ou une entrée utilisateur supplémentaire sont mieux gérées au premier plan, tandis que les commandes de base peuvent être gérées en arrière-plan.

Classes

VoiceCommand

Commande donnée à Cortana, à l’aide de la parole ou du texte, et acheminée vers une application en arrière-plan.

La commande doit être déclarée dans un fichier VCD (Voice Command Definition) inscrit par l’application mentionnée dans la commande. Pour plus d’informations sur la création et l’inscription d’un fichier VCD (Voice Command Definition) pour votre application, consultez Lancer une application en arrière-plan avec des commandes vocales .

VoiceCommandCompletedEventArgs

Contient des données d’événement pour l’événement VoiceCommandCompleted .

VoiceCommandConfirmationResult

Réponse à la question spécifiée par l’application d’arrière-plan et affichée sur l’écran de confirmation Cortana . Cet écran s’affiche lorsque le service d’application en arrière-plan appelle RequestConfirmationAsync.

VoiceCommandContentTile

Ressource, contenant des données d’image, de texte et de liaison, fournie par le service d’application d’arrière-plan pour l’affichage sur le canevas Cortana .

VoiceCommandDefinition

Active les opérations sur un jeu de commandes installé spécifique.

VoiceCommandDefinitionManager

Classe statique qui permet d’inscrire et d’utiliser des jeux de commandes à partir d’un fichier de données de commande vocale (VCD).

VoiceCommandDisambiguationResult

Résultat obtenu à partir de l’écran de désambiguisation affiché sur le canevas Cortana .

L’appel de RequestDisambiguationAsync à partir du service d’application en arrière-plan permet à Cortana d’afficher l’écran de désambiguation.

VoiceCommandResponse

Réponse d’un service d’application en arrière-plan pour les écrans de progression, de confirmation, d’ambiguïté, d’achèvement ou d’échec affichés sur le canevas Cortana .

VoiceCommandServiceConnection

Connexion app service en arrière-plan à Cortana.

Permet de récupérer la commande vocale de Cortana et de présenter des messages qui sont prononcés par Cortana et affichés sur le canevas Cortana .

VoiceCommandUserMessage

Message prononcé par Cortana et affiché sur le canevas Cortana .

Ce message doit être :

Énumérations

VoiceCommandCompletionReason

Spécifie les raisons possibles pour lesquelles la commande vocale s’est terminée.

VoiceCommandContentTileType

Modèle de disposition utilisé pour les vignettes de contenu sur le canevas Cortana .

Spécifiez le modèle avec la propriété ContentTileType .

Notes

Toutes les vignettes de contenu d’un écran de commentaires Cortana doivent utiliser le même modèle.

Voir aussi